Transaction 70c88276b580710f57591571a5c5b94f652944b2248542fe393420122afbb60a

1 Input
2 Outputs
  • 70c88276b580710f57591571a5c5b94f652944b2248542fe393420122afbb60a:0
  • value  1816141
    address  36KCkAqbZo1t4cQ6ZR12fSDKMRoo1vU5vZ
  • 70c88276b580710f57591571a5c5b94f652944b2248542fe393420122afbb60a:1
  • value  574040114
    address  3PgTZoTfBX5R6vPRC253cr6LwFqwpEjf7S